Today while looking around in a field full of military surplus , I came across some wheels which caught my attention . Can someone help identify what they might fit . They appear to be 20 inch diameter , 10 lug , about 13 inches wide (rim edge to rim edge )
They are one piece wheels ,not bolt together ,not split ring .
The center is offset about 75% to one side
The wheels have bar coded tags with NSN 2530010380805 and
DTID w35n4092730803
I asked what they fit and was told he had no idea , but would take $20 apiece . Wheels are in great condition ,just dont know what their good for .
